Run Gun ZR is an innovative take on the infinite runner genre, released in 2023. This indie simulator takes the classic gameplay mechanics of dodging and jumping over obstacles and adds a unique VR twist. Players navigate a vibrant world filled with zombies, utilizing their hands to vault over challenges while unlocking various weapons that enhance their chances of survival.
